Stack Overflow版主选举实时监视器SOVoteMonitor

需积分: 5 0 下载量 198 浏览量 更新于2024-11-09 收藏 36KB ZIP 举报
资源摘要信息:"SOVoteMonitor: SO Election 2015 投票监视器是一个专为Stack Overflow版主选举设计的实时投票监控工具。该工具可以实时监视投票活动,并且包含更多细节,用以确保选举的透明度和公正性。" 在进行详细的知识点分析之前,首先需要对Stack Overflow这个平台有一个基础性的了解。Stack Overflow是一个以程序员为中心的问答网站,社区成员可以通过提问和回答来分享知识和经验。其中,版主的选举是为了让社区更加有序,并确保其健康发展的关键步骤。版主拥有维护社区规则、管理内容以及决定其他社区事务的权利。 从标题和描述中,我们可以提炼出以下几个重要的知识点: 1. Stack Overflow 社区管理:Stack Overflow是一个全球性的编程问答社区,汇集了来自世界各地的专业开发者。社区通过设定规则和机制,比如版主选举,来维护秩序和推动知识共享。 2. 版主选举机制:版主通常由社区成员投票产生,负责监督和维护社区规则。他们有责任确保社区的讨论和内容质量,以及帮助解决社区内部的冲突。 3. 实时投票监视器的作用:SOVoteMonitor作为一个实时投票监视器,能够确保投票过程的透明度。它可能包括投票计数、选举进度实时更新、投票异常监测等功能,以预防作弊行为并保护选举的公正性。 4. Java 编程语言的应用:文件标签中提及的“Java”意味着SOVoteMonitor监视器的开发使用了Java语言。Java是一种广泛使用的、面向对象的编程语言,具有跨平台的特性,适合于开发需要跨平台运行的应用程序。使用Java作为开发语言,有助于创建高效稳定的应用程序,来支持高并发访问和数据处理。 5. 文件名称 "SOVoteMonitor-master":这个文件名称暗示了这是一个开源项目,"master"通常表示主分支或主版本。在Git等版本控制系统中,"master"分支往往用来存放项目的主线开发代码。这表明SOVoteMonitor可能是开源的,用户可以通过获取源代码来了解其工作原理,甚至可以自己进行扩展和改进。 综合上述分析,可以得出SOVoteMonitor是一个使用Java开发的、用于监控Stack Overflow社区版主选举的实时投票监视系统。它不仅确保了选举过程的透明度和公正性,而且其可能采用的开源特性也为社区的参与和贡献提供了机会。在技术层面,它需要处理高并发的数据输入,进行实时的数据统计与展示,并可能包含投票安全性的检查机制。此外,它还可能利用到网络编程、数据库操作、前端展示等多方面的IT技术知识。